The Village Show has reluctantly been cancelled this year due to current uncertainties over rising Covid infections locally. The Show Committee very much hopes that the Show will go ahead in August 2022 and would like to thank everyone for their support this year.

Austwick W.I: Members enjoyed ‘A Summer Evening Buffet’ at Battle Hill, courtesy of Lindsey Smith. Luckily the weather stayed fine and the sun shone enabling guests to wander around the garden and eat outside.

The next meeting on Thursday August 12th will be in Austwick Parish Hall at 7.30pm and will be a talk by Archaeologist Jamie Quartermaine.
